Wood Cabinet Staining in Dayton, OH
Wood cabinet staining services involve applying a durable, high-quality finish to enhance the appearance and longevity of wooden cabinetry. This process is commonly used on kitchen cabinets, bathroom vanities, built-in shelving, and other wood features within a home. Property owners typically seek staining to deepen or alter the color of existing wood, highlight the natural grain, or update the look of cabinetry without replacing the entire piece. Before requesting this service, homeowners often want to understand the types of stains available, the expected results, and how the finish will complement the overall interior design.
It is important for property owners to consider the condition of the existing wood surface, as staining works best on clean, smooth, and well-maintained wood. They should also inquire about the different stain options, such as oil-based or water-based, and how each might affect the appearance and durability of the finish. Clarifying the scope of the project, including preparation work like sanding and cleaning, can ensure expectations are aligned and that the final result enhances the style and functionality of the cabinetry.

Wood Cabinet Staining Questions
What types of wood cabinets can be stained? Wood staining services typically work on a variety of cabinet types, including oak, maple, cherry, and pine, to enhance their appearance and protect the surface.
Are stain colors customizable for cabinets? Yes, a range of stain colors and shades are available to match or complement existing decor and personal preferences.
Can stained cabinets be updated or changed later? Yes, stained cabinets can often be re-stained or refinished to refresh their look or change the color as desired.
What is the benefit of staining over painting cabinets? Staining allows the natural grain and character of the wood to show through, providing a warm, authentic look that paint may not achieve.
